4.5 Keyboard
The keyboard consists of three function keys ENTER, BRK and C and ten numerical keys.
Several keys have double functions. They can be used for entering data and for navigating through scroll lists.
The arrow-shaped keys , , and are used as cursor keys in the selection mode and for entering digits and
letters in the input mode.
Tab. 4.1: General functions
ENTER confirmation of selection or of entered value
BRK + C + ENTER RESET: Press these three keys simultaneously to correct a malfunction. The reset has the same
effect as restarting the transmitter. Stored data are not affected.
BRK interruption of the measurement and selection of the main menu
Be careful not to stop a current measurement by inadvertently pressing key BRK!
